About The Event
A remarkable and impressive debut collection of poems that speak to the complexity of family, identity and the proud legacy of Māori language and culture.
The poetic visions of Mettle echo through past and present lives – memories are recorded and futures imagined. Te Whiu draws on stories from her childhood and a lifetime of listening and learning about her whakapapa (Māori lineage).
This exceptional collection resounds with strength – a mettle that ripples not just through Te Whiu’s own life but that of her ancestral family. Her moving, graceful poems are a lens through which to look ‘now’ straight in the face, without shame or fear, and to acknowledge that while trauma is transmitted generationally, so too are the gifts of resilience and fortitude.
